How Sales Deals Are Refined
When a consumer makes a decision to make a purchase, the sales deal initiates a collection of systematic actions within the POS system. The cashier inputs the products being purchased, which are checked through a barcode visitor or manually gotten in. This action recovers product information, including pricing and suitable taxes, from the system's database.Next, the client exists with the overall quantity due. The POS system then refines the settlement, whether with cash, charge card, or mobile repayment approaches (Restaurant POS Software). For digital repayments, the POS firmly interacts with settlement processors to authorize and verify the transaction.Once the payment is verified, the system produces an invoice, which can be printed or sent electronically. This invoice serves as receipt for the client. The purchase data is recorded in the system, guaranteeing accurate sales documents and monetary tracking for the company.
Inventory Monitoring and Tracking

Effective supply administration and monitoring are vital elements of a POS system, as they ensure that organizations maintain optimal supply levels and reduce discrepancies. A durable POS system permits real-time stock updates, mirroring returns and sales immediately. This enables company owner to keep an eye on stock levels precisely, making certain that preferred products are readily offered while preventing overstocking of less popular products.Additionally, progressed POS systems supply functions such as computerized supply alerts and reorder recommendations, enhancing the procurement procedure. Barcoding and RFID innovation boost precision in tracking inventory motion, lowering human error. Substantial reporting devices supply understandings right into stock turnover prices, aiding organizations make informed decisions concerning purchasing and product offerings. Inevitably, reliable inventory monitoring with a POS system not just enhances operational effectiveness yet also enhances client complete satisfaction by making certain item availability.
